I went on a Duck today. It's fun to ride a Duck. It's worth the money if you ever go to Boston. The ride is fun with riding in and out of the water and you get to see like everything in Boston in about an hour and a half. Plus all the drivers are funny and nice.(or at least the ones I met. Our driver was the employee of the month so I'm not sure how the other ones do)
